A whiskey glass designed by Finnish glass artist Tapio Wirkkala. Tapio Wirkkala is a legendary designer who belongs to Iittala, and is a great master representing Scandinavian modernity in Finland in the 20th century who was involved in all kinds of industrial design such as fixtures, furniture, and stamps.

The series name Marusuki means "march" in Finnish. There are multiple size variations in the same series. This is a 240ml size that fits perfectly in your hand.

The main body has a bamboo knot-like projection that makes it easy to hold. The shape is not a straight body, but rather tapered toward the rim, and is shaped so that the scent of whiskey will accumulate. The bottom is rounded like a wine bottle and is made to prevent condensation even if ice accumulates. It looks like a light and elegant form, but it is a solid glass that is heavier than it looks like it is for whiskey. Since it was manufactured in a Finnish factory about half a century ago, the finishing is done by hand by the craftsmen of the time.

Iittala products were pasted with a triangle sticker from the late 1950s to the early 1970s. Since this is a seal after being renovated in the 70's, I think it was manufactured in the late 1970's. This work is currently out of print and has not been reprinted, so it is a series that can only be obtained in vintage.

Tapio Wirkkala (1915-1985)

An important figure in Finnish industrial design, he left behind genius achievements in a variety of design fields. His extensive body of work ranges from glass, furniture and product design to sculpture, urban planning and Finnish banknotes. While his work was internationally acclaimed and he held exhibitions all over the country, he was a man who loved nature and preferred solitude, and lived in a mountain hut in a deep forest area. His unique perspective has brought him numerous awards, most notably the Gold Medal at the Milan Triennale three times.

In 1946, Virkala won the first design award at Iittala's competition and became the company's art director, gaining worldwide recognition. His achievements include over 400 glass works created for Iittala, especially the Ultima Thule series and Tapio series, which are still loved by many people today.
